Title: Masanobu Yoshida: Innovator in Sheet Feeding Devices
Introduction
Masanobu Yoshida is a notable inventor based in Kanagawa, Japan. He has made significant contributions to the field of image forming systems, holding a total of 4 patents. His work primarily focuses on enhancing the efficiency and functionality of sheet feeding devices.
Latest Patents
Yoshida's latest patents include a sheet feeding device and an image forming apparatus. The sheet feeding device features a housing, a sheet stacker, a stacker elevator, an extension sheet stacker, and a support. This innovative design allows for effective stacking and elevating of sheets, with the extension sheet stacker configured to extend outward from the housing. The support includes an inclined portion that aids in the conveyance of sheets. The image forming apparatus consists of a sheet bundle housing unit that accommodates recording sheets. It incorporates a swing member that moves between projection and non-projection positions, along with a sheet detection unit and an interlocking mechanism that enhances its functionality.
